区块链技术自从比特币的成功面世以来,就被广泛认为是一项革命性的技术。由于其去中心化、不可篡改的特性,区块链在金融、供应链管理、数据保护等多个领域展现出了巨大的潜力。百度作为中国最大的互联网公司之一,自然也不能忽视这一技术的发展与应用。百度云不仅建立了自己的区块链平台,还为多个行业的企业提供了解决方案。本文将详细探讨百度云的区块链系统,包括其技术架构、实际应用案例以及未来发展方向。
在深入了解百度区块链之前,首先要了解其基础架构。百度区块链平台是一个开放的区块链服务平台,提供了一系列工具和API,帮助企业快速搭建区块链应用。其架构主要分为多个层次,包括网络层、数据层、智能合约层和应用层。
1. **网络层**:这一层是整个平台的基础,负责节点的管理、数据的传输和存储等。百度云区块链采用了分布式网络,每个节点都保存有区块链的副本,确保数据的完整性与安全性。
2. **数据层**:在这一层,所有的交易记录和数据都以区块的形式存储。百度采用了先进的加密算法,确保交易数据无法被篡改。这一层不仅包括整体的链数据结构,还包含智能合约的代码和状态。
3. **智能合约层**:智能合约是区块链应用的核心,它允许用户预设条件,一旦条件满足便自动执行合约。百度的智能合约支持多种编程语言,极大地提高了开发的灵活性与易用性。
4. **应用层**:这一层是面向用户的,提供了各种API和SDK支持开发。同时,百度云也为不同行业提供了示范应用和模板,帮助企业快速上手。
百度区块链系统在多个场景中得到了应用,这里列举几个典型案例:
1. **金融领域**:百度与多家银行及金融机构合作,利用区块链技术改进了供应链融资的效率。例如,通过使用区块链对供应链进行透明化管理,有效降低了金融风险。
2. **医疗健康**:在这个领域,百度区块链应用于电子健康记录(EHR)的系统中,患者可以通过区块链技术,实现对自己健康数据的控制与管理。医生和医疗机构可以在遵守隐私保护法规的前提下,方便地获取患者的健康信息。
3. **版权保护**:在音乐和艺术作品的领域,百度区块链应用被用来记录和验证创作的版权信息。艺术作品在链上登记后,任何人都无法篡改其信息,从而有效保护创作者的权益。
4. **票据管理**:百度云与相关机构合作,推出基于区块链的电子票据解决方案。传统纸质票据容易伪造和遗失,而区块链的不可篡改性和透明性,为票据管理提供了新的思路。
随着区块链技术的不断发展,百度云区块链的潜力也愈发显现。然而,仍然面临一些挑战。
1. **技术标准化**:目前区块链技术存在多个不同的标准和协议,行业内尚未形成统一的技术标准,这可能限制了各类区块链应用的互操作性。
2. **法律法规**:由于区块链技术的去中心化特性,许多国家和地区的法律对其认证和监管尚不明确。百度云区块链需要密切关注相关政策变化,以确保其应用不会触犯法律。
3. **安全性**:尽管区块链技术被认为是安全的,但仍然存在被攻击的风险。因此,百度需要不断更新和强化其安全措施,防止黑客攻击和数据泄露。
4. **市场竞争**:随着越来越多的企业进入这一领域,竞争将变得日益激烈。百度云需要不断创新,提升自身的产品和服务能力,以在市场上占得一席之地。
区块链技术的去中心化特性使得它在许多传统行业中扮演了颠覆者的角色。在金融领域,传统的中心化银行系统面临着效率低下和透明度不足的问题。通过引入区块链,金融交易可以实时结算,降低了操作成本,同时提高了透明度。比如,供应链管理行业通过区块链可以提升物流追踪的可视化和防伪能力。
区块链还能够验证信息的真实性,特别是在食品安全、商品溯源等领域,确保消费者能够获得真实的信息。总体来看,区块链技术为传统行业提供了新的运作方式,使其更加高效和透明。
为了保障消息传输和数据存储的安全,百度区块链采取了一系列安全措施。首先,采用加密技术保护交易数据。在区块链上,所有的数据都在创建时进行加密,只有合适的密钥才能解码,从而提高数据的私密性和安全性。
其次,数据的不可篡改性也是一个重要因素。一旦数据上链,便不会再被修改,这使得用户可以信赖区块链上的信息。此外,百度区块链的节点分布式存储架构,使得即使个别节点出现问题,整体网络依然能够安全运行。最后,百度还不断监控可能的安全威胁,并通过技术升级和安全审计来强化其安全性。
百度云区块链具备广泛的适用性,可以应用于多个行业。首先是金融行业,尤其是在供应链金融、跨境结算等场景中,能够大幅提升交易效率和透明度。其次在医疗健康行业,患者的电子健康记录通过区块链存储,可以确保数据安全并实现便捷的互通。
此外,在物联网行业,基于区块链的设备身份管理能够提高设备的安全性和可信度。在版权保护、投票系统等领域,通过区块链的透明性和可追溯性,能够有效降低欺诈行为的发生。综上所述,百度云区块链适应的行业非常广泛,几乎涵盖了所有与数据和信任密切相关的领域。
百度云为开发者提供了一整套区块链开发工具和环境,帮助他们快速上手。首先,开发者需要注册百度云账号,进入到百度云区块链平台。该平台提供了清晰的应用程序接口(API)和软件开发工具包(SDK),方便用户进行二次开发。
其次,百度云区块链平台提供了多种示例和模板,尤其是在智能合约的编写上,开发者可以参考已有的合约模型进行修改和扩展。同时,百度云还提供了详细的文档和技术支持,帮助开发者在开发过程中解决遇到的问题。
最后,开发者可以通过模拟环境进行测试,确保合约的逻辑和功能正常运行,再部署到真实环境进行使用。这种灵活的开发与测试机制大大降低了开发者的门槛,使得更多企业和个人能够享受到区块链技术带来的优势。
未来区块链技术将持续发展,并朝几个方向演进。首先,跨链技术将会成为热点。由于目前各个平台之间数据孤岛现象严重,跨链技术能够实现不同区块链之间的信息交换和互操作,为多样化的业务场景提供支持。
其次,普及和标准化是另一个重要方向。随着越来越多的企业和行业参与区块链的应用,行业标准的制定和技术的普及将会成为必要条件,以便于不同系统的兼容性与协作。
此外,随着监管政策的逐渐成熟,区块链将会迎来合法合规的环境,促进更多商业机遇的出现。据此,未来将可能看到区块链在公共服务、政府透明度等领域的广泛应用。总之,区块链技术的未来充满了希望,随着技术和应用的不断深化,我们即将见证一个更加智能和透明的世界。
综上所述,百度云区块链系统通过其先进的技术架构和丰富的实际应用,为多个行业的数字化转型提供了坚实的基础。虽然在发展的过程中面临着诸多挑战,但其未来的发展前景依旧光明。随着技术的持续创新和应用场景的不断拓展,百度云区块链将会在未来的数字经济中发挥更加重要的作用。